xref: /llvm-project/clang/test/Modules/interface-diagnose-missing-import.m (revision 6ba4afb4d6f2f8f293ad704a37de4139c5c8c0f0)
1// RUN: rm -rf %t
2// RUN: %clang_cc1 %s -fsyntax-only -fmodules -fimplicit-module-maps -fmodules-cache-path=%t -F%S/Inputs/interface-diagnose-missing-import -verify
3// expected-no-diagnostics
4@interface NSObject @end
5@interface Buggy : NSObject
6@end
7
8@import Foo.Bar;
9
10// No diagnostic for inaccessible 'Buggy' definition because we have another definition right in this file.
11@interface Buggy (MyExt)
12@end
13